http://www.catholiclane.com/simon-of-cyrene-and-the-scandal-of-the-cross/ WebbIf the Rufus mentioned by Paul is the son of Simon of Cyrene, it would make sense for Mark to also mention him by name as he wrote his gospel and sent it to Rome. There would really be no other reason to mention Simon's sons by name. So, we have one of Simon's sons, a half a generation later, a member of the body at Rome. WebbMark alone tells that Simon was the father of Alexander and Rufus. From this statement of the evangelist, it is apparent that at the time the Second Gospel was written, Alexander and Rufus were Christians, and that they were well known in the Christian community.
